1980S Home Video Game Systems . This list features consoles that brought gaming into our homes and helped shape the industry. The decade witnessed the rise of fierce competition between gaming giants, especially sega and nintendo, as they battled for market dominance.
Original Atari Game System from ar.inspiredpencil.com
This iconic console introduced the concept of gaming in the comfort of your living room, effectively pioneering home. The 1980s gaming landscape owes much of its foundation to the atari 2600. The atari 2600, which had been introduced in the late 70s, was still popular at the start of the decade, but it soon faced competition from more advanced systems.
